Tips for Taking the Best Photos of Your Dog

Do you want to take some photos of your furry friend? Read below to learn tips for taking the best photos of your dog!

Use Treats and Toys

Treats and toys are a great way to get your pal’s attention. This is especially helpful if you are trying to take a portrait of your companion. Additionally, these items will encourage your pal to look at you while you snap some photos. However, be sure to reward your pet for a job well done!

Have an Assistant

Additionally, an assistant can be a valuable tool when taking photos of your dog. Your assistant can hold the treat or toy to get your pal’s attention. Or, they can throw a ball and engage your pet if you want to capture an action shot!

Get On Your Pal’s Level

Crouching down or lying on the floor is the best way to capture a photo of your pal. This method is much better than snapping a picture from overhead. Additionally, try some shots where you get in close and ones where you are further away.

Use Simple Backgrounds

Also, utilizing simple backgrounds will help highlight your pet and make them the center of attention. For example, some great options are plain walls, large patches of grass, or a solid-colored carpet.

Utilize Natural Light

Natural light provides the best photos. Additionally, some pups may be nervous around the flash. So, it is best to avoid it. The best way to do this is by having your photoshoot outside or near a window.

Talk To Your Companion

Dogs understand our words and emotions. So, use this to your advantage! Talk to your furry friend to get some fun and exciting photos.

Highlight Their Personality

Try to capture your pal’s personality in the photos you take. Are they a goofball? Do they have a lot of energy? Or are they a couch potato? Take action or still shots to highlight your canine’s charm.
